Ingredients of Radish Pork Ribs Stew
-
Prepare 1 pcs of white radish.
-
Prepare As needed of Pork ribs.
-
You need To taste of Cinnamon powder.
-
You need To taste of Light soy sauce.
-
You need To taste of Dark soy sauce.
-
It’s half of Garlic cut into.
-
Prepare half of Shallot, cut into.
-
It’s of Few slices of ginger.
-
Prepare As needed of Cooking wine.

Radish Pork Ribs Stew step by step
-
Add cooking oil in a wok then saute garlic, shallot and ginger then add in ribs..
-
Stir fry until ribs turns into golden brown..
-
Add in radish and add 2 cups of water..
-
Simmer until radish is soft. Serve.
-
Then add cinnamon, light, dry soy sauce and wine..
